What Exactly Is a Mini Split Line Set?

At its core, a mini split line set is a pair of copper tubes:

The larger suction line carries refrigerant gas back to the outdoor unit.

The smaller liquid line sends refrigerant into the indoor unit.

Both are insulated to prevent energy loss, condensation, and corrosion. Together, they form the bridge that keeps your home cool in summer and warm in winter.

The Cost of Cutting Corners

Too many homeowners let installers reuse old line sets or buy bargain-bin tubing online. Here’s what usually happens when you cut costs:

Refrigerant Leaks: Thin or corroded copper can’t handle modern high-pressure refrigerants.

Efficiency Losses: Poor insulation lets heat seep in, forcing the system to work harder.

Premature Failures: Compressors, one of the most expensive parts of a mini split, often fail when paired with undersized or leaking lines.

Moisture Damage: Condensation from inadequate insulation can rot drywall and invite mold.

Installation Best Practices Pros Swear By

Even the best line set can fail if it’s installed poorly. Here’s what technicians emphasize:

Avoid Sharp Bends: Over-bending copper can weaken the tubing and cause cracks.

Protect the Insulation: Seal ends properly to keep moisture and pests out.

Pressure-Test Before Charging: Always test for leaks before adding refrigerant.

Proper Length Runs: Excessively long line sets can reduce efficiency; always stay within manufacturer limits.

Understanding the Basics: What Is a Mini Split Line Set?

A mini split line set connects the indoor air handler to the outdoor condenser. It usually includes:

Suction Line – The larger copper tube that carries refrigerant vapor back to the outdoor unit.

Liquid Line – The smaller copper tube that brings liquid refrigerant into the indoor coil.

Insulation Layer – Protective foam wrapping around the suction line to prevent energy loss and sweating.

This might sound simple, but the quality of each component directly influences efficiency and lifespan.

How to Choose the Perfect Line Set for Your Mini Split

1. Match the Manufacturer’s Specs

Every mini split model is engineered for specific line diameters. Using undersized or oversized tubing disrupts refrigerant balance and voids warranties. line set

2. Consider the Distance

Standard line sets are 15 to 25 feet long, but some installations require extensions. Exceeding manufacturer-recommended lengths often demands additional refrigerant charges or accessories.

3. Pay Attention to Copper Quality

Refrigeration-grade copper is seamless and designed for high pressures. Plumbing copper, on the other hand, is not suited for refrigerants and can fail under stress.

4. Don’t Overlook Insulation

The suction line must always be insulated. In hot climates, go for UV-resistant, thick insulation to prevent cracking and condensation damage.

Pro Installation: What Technicians Do Differently

Even the best line set fails if mishandled during installation. Experienced installers follow best practices such as:

Minimizing Sharp Bends – Reducing restrictions that choke refrigerant flow.

Pressure Testing – Using nitrogen to check for leaks before starting the system.

Vacuuming the Lines – Removing moisture and air that could freeze or corrode components.

Protecting Outdoor Runs – Using line set covers or conduits to shield against weather and pests.

These steps separate professional setups from DIY jobs gone wrong.

Can You Reuse an Old Line Set?

This is a common question during upgrades. The honest answer: sometimes, but rarely advisable.

Safe to reuse if the copper is in excellent condition, correctly sized, and compatible with the new refrigerant.

Replace immediately if the insulation is deteriorating, the tubing is dented, or the system is switching to a newer refrigerant like R-410A.

Given the labor costs of replacing a failed reused line set later, most professionals recommend replacing it upfront.

Cost Considerations: Investment vs. Savings

A quality mini split line set generally costs between $150 to $400, depending on length, copper thickness, and insulation type. While that may seem like a small part of the total system, it plays a huge role in efficiency.

Cut corners here, and you’ll pay in higher energy bills, more service calls, and potential compressor replacements down the road.
